6 , 7 Apart from neurological disorders, MAO enzymes are quite significant in cardiovascular and vascular diseases and so on. 8 , 9 Both MAO enzymes have a substrate-binding cavity and an entrance cavity in which the substrate-binding sites are hydrophobic and are enclosed with aromatic and aliphatic residues. 10 In human MAO-A, the substrate-binding site is a 400 Å 3 cavity, but in MAO-B, a smaller lipophilic cavity, called the entry cavity, sits between the main substrate-binding site and the protein surface. 11 Depending on the substrate or inhibitor present, the cavities remain separate or get interconnected.
